This article addresses the dark and barely known side of one of the most iconic symbols of Spanish heritage: the Palaeolithic cave of Altamira (region of Cantabria). The cave is a benchmark of European rock art and was declared a World Heritage Site by UNESCO in 1985. Access to the cave’s guestbook (inaugurated on 18 August 1928 with King Alfonso XIII’s signature) has granted us the opportunity to deconstruct the hegemonic discourse therein, and to approach a time, the Spanish Civil War (1936–1939), which had been left almost without discussion in historical literature on the archaeological site. Conflict Archaeology can cast light on this unknown reality and raise controversial and contentious issues about the Altamira cave and its role as a wartime cultural asset during the war.  相似文献

There is limited available data on the environmental context of the arrival of the first anatomically modern humans (AMH) in North Africa, and subsequent Paleolithic and Neolithic occupations within this region. Microvertebrates such as rodents, shrews, amphibians, and squamates are known to be good indicators of climate and landscape changes. They also represent continental paleoecological records that can be directly related to human occupations. Moreover, faunas and humans have been subjected to several dispersal waves through similar routes, and some rodents may present anthropophilous behavior. Therefore, by understanding the dispersal pattern and pathways of these microvertebrates, it is possible to propose scenarios for human dispersal events. In this study we took the rich microfaunal assemblages from the Témara region, Atlantic Morocco (El Harhoura 2 and El Mnasra Caves), and placed them within a broader synthesis, in order to highlight the role of microvertebrates in providing a better understanding of the human-environment relationship during the Late Quaternary in North Africa.  相似文献

The excavation of Tunel VII, a Yamana site dating to the indigenous/European contact period was part of a long term research project based on the north coast of the Beagle channel (Tierra del Fuego, Argentina). The aim was to evaluate the theory and methodologies and devise an archaeological method that would enable a complete picture of subsistence strategies to be constructed. At Tunel VII (a site with shell middens), we were able to analyse these strategies through 10 successive occupation events on a single location. Archaeozoological analysis of the faunal remains and use-wear analysis of lithic material were used to examine the management of resources. Production and consumption are two very useful concepts, and together they have been used to create a methodology, which, together with spatial analysis using significant variables, has enabled identification of recurrent or significant tendencies in relation to alteration or continuity in subsistence strategies. In the case of Tunel VII, we know that the people who continually occupied the hut were all from the same group.  相似文献

Due to their problematic stratigraphy, shell middens have traditionally been excavated by artificial stratigraphical cuts. This approach has often led to the obliteration of the original depositional sequence, removing important information regarding depositional and post-depositional processes, and human frequentation. Since the 1970s, an Argentinian team has been excavating archaeological shell middens in the Beagle Channel with a detailed stratigraphical approach, based on the excavation of actual depositional units (peeling), rather than artificial cuts. In the 1980s, Spanish archaeologists joined the Argentinean team and launched a series of new projects involving the excavation of ethnohistorical Yamana fisher-hunter-gatherer sites. The first excavated midden site was Tunel VII, from which two monolith columns of about 50 cm each (C11 and C12) that spanned the whole stratigraphy were extracted. The two columns were consolidated with resin, and two series of thin sections produced to corroborate stratigraphical observations made in the field, and to verify hypotheses related to the formation of archaeological shell midden sites. We present here the first results obtained from the microscopical observation of seven thin sections from column 11 (West column), extracted from a portion of the profile originally described as corresponding to the hut entrance and associated floor. The observation of microscopical features invisible in the field has provided supplemental information about the depositional and post-depositional processes affecting shell midden sites. We have also preliminarily defined a number of micromorphological characteristics identifying human activities such as discrete shell deposition events, phases of preparation of the hut floor, and compression by repeated trampling. Finally, we have explored the possibility of establishing some guidelines to characterise the length and character of frequentation phases of the site previous to its final abandonment at the beginning of the 20th century.  相似文献

Commonly used in archaeological contexts, micromorphology did not see a parallel advance in the field of experimental archaeology. Drawing from early work conducted in the 1990’s on ethnohistoric sites in the Beagle Channel, we analyze a set of 25 thin sections taken from control features and experimental tests. The control features include animal pathways and environmental contexts (beach samples, forest litter, soils from the proximities of archaeological sites), while the experimental samples comprise anthropic structures, such as hearths, and valves of Mytilus edulis (the most important component of shell middens in the region) heated from 200 °C to 800 °C. Their micromorphological study constitutes a modern analogue to assist archaeologists studying site formation and ethnographical settings in cold climates, with particular emphasis on shell midden contexts.  相似文献

This paper aims to analyze the emergence of ethnicity and cultural differentiation in hunter–gatherer groups, using computer simulation methods. The existence of differences and similarities between populations has long been a major topic of investigation for archaeologists, who have traditionally used material culture as a means to identify different human groups. Today, this approach is perceived as being too simplistic. However, in the absence of satisfactory models, it often continues to be assumed as valid. In this paper, we present a preliminary model and its computer implementation to predict how hunter–gatherer societies interacted and built cultural identities as a consequence of the way they interacted. Our starting point for such analysis assumes the definition of ethnicity as the production and reproduction of group identity among members of a community, resulting from restricted cooperation flows. Results are compared with ongoing ethnoarchaeological research of Patagonian hunter–gatherers.  相似文献
